EXO 24:15 And Moses went up into the mount, and a cloud covered the
mount.
EXO 24:16 And the glory of the LORD abode upon mount Sinai, and the
cloud covered it six days: and the seventh day he called unto Moses out
of the midst of the cloud.

GEN 33:18 And Jacob came to Shalem, a city of Shechem, which is in the
land of Canaan, when he came from Padanaram; and pitched his tent before
the city.
GEN 33:19 And he bought a parcel of a field, where he had spread his
tent, at the hand of the children of Hamor, Shechem's father, for an
hundred pieces of money.
GEN 33:20 And he erected there an altar, and called it EleloheIsrael.
GEN 34:1 And Dinah the daughter of Leah, which she bare unto Jacob,
went out to see the daughters of the land.

HOS 2:8 For she did not know that I gave her corn, and wine, and oil,
and multiplied her silver and gold, which they prepared for Baal.
HOS 2:9 Therefore will I return, and take away my corn in the time
thereof, and my wine in the season thereof, and will recover my wool and
my flax given to cover her nakedness.
HOS 2:10 And now will I discover her lewdness in the sight of her
lovers, and none shall deliver her out of mine hand.
HOS 2:11 I will also cause all her mirth to cease, her feast days, her
new moons, and her sabbaths, and all her solemn feasts.
